Настройка резервного копирования — ежедневные бэкапы с проверкой восстановления и алертами
Большинство компаний думают что у них настроены бэкапы. Узнают об ошибке в самый неподходящий момент. Мы настраиваем бэкапы по правилу 3-2-1 с реальным тестом восстановления.
Правило 3-2-1 — индустриальный стандарт бэкапов
3 копии данных
Оригинал + 2 бэкапа. Один локальный бэкап — это не бэкап.
2 разных типа носителей
Локальный диск сервера и облачное хранилище S3.
1 копия вне сервера (off-site)
Яндекс Object Storage, Selectel S3. Если дата-центр сгорит — данные уцелеют.
Тестирование восстановления
Бэкап без проверки восстановления — это кот в мешке. Мы делаем тестовый разворот.
Что входит в настройку
Ежедневные авто-бэкапы
Настройка cron/systemd-таймеров. Бэкапы делаются ночью, не нагружая production сервер.
Бэкап БД с консистентностью
MySQL, PostgreSQL, MongoDB, Redis. Используем нативные утилиты дампа без потери данных.
Внешнее хранилище S3
Синхронизация в Selectel S3, Яндекс Object Storage, VK Cloud. Сжатие и шифрование перед отправкой.
Умная ротация
Храним ежедневные 7 дней, еженедельные 4 недели, ежемесячные 12 месяцев. Экономим место.
Тест восстановления
Мы реально разворачиваем бэкап и проверяем целостность. Вы узнаете точное время RTO (Recovery Time Objective).
Telegram-алерт при сбое
Если бэкап не прошел ночью (нет места, ошибка сети), вы получаете уведомление утром.
Сравнение: Нет бэкапов vs Правило 3-2-1
| Сценарий | Нет бэкапов | Только локальный бэкап | Правило 3-2-1 (11 900 ₽) |
|---|---|---|---|
| Сбой диска на сервере | Всё потеряно | Всё потеряно | Восстановление из внешней S3-копии |
| Взлом / шифровальщик | Всё потеряно | Часто тоже зашифровано | Внешняя копия не затронута |
| Алерт при сбое бэкапа | Нет | Нет | Telegram-алерт утром |
| Проверка восстановления | — | — | Протестировано при настройке |